Technology

The Flying Start Technology Degree Apprenticeship programme lasts four years and will fast track your career in Technology, it can be studied at the University of Birmingham, the University of Leeds and Queen’s University Belfast.

You’ll study towards a full BSc degree in Computer Science or Software Engineering, depending on which University you attend, and gain the relevant apprenticeship qualification too. The degree is fully funded which means you don’t need to pay your tuition fees, and as a PwC apprentice from day one, you’ll be paid a salary throughout your degree programme*.  During the programme you’ll have work placements with us where you’ll work on cutting-edge digital and technology projects, supporting both our internal teams and our clients. At PwC, our technology teams are diverse, ranging from Cyber Security, Data and Analytics, Technology Consulting and Forensic Technology to name but a few.

 What you’ll need

  • AAA - BBB at A-Level or equivalent including Maths or Computer Science. Entry requirements vary between each university, so please visit our website for specific entry details
  • You may be eligible for a reduced offer if you fulfil the Widening Participation criteria of the university, so please check our website for links to further information about university Access programmes. 
  • Each university has their own admissions policy to consider applications. Please refer to the relevant policy from our partner universities to determine your eligibility should you feel your circumstances impact on your application.
